What you will do
In the Senior Budget Analyst role, you will:

• Lead the Financial Management team to ensure effective and efficient delivery of reporting, budgetary, forecasting and advisory services.
• Contribute to the development of the annual capital and operational budgets including liaising with managers and providing advice on the development of their individual budgets.
• Develop and maintain the agency's budget management and reporting systems.
• Provide monthly reporting to support the monitoring and analysis of business areas' performance in terms of expenditure, identifying and explaining variances.
• Prepare short and long-term forecast projections for agency-wide activities in consultation with stakeholders.
• Provide analysis, recommendations and expert advice to the Manager, Financial Services and stakeholders to inform sound management decisions within funding constraints.
• Undertake complex research activities and prepare submissions, reports and briefing materials on budget development, financial policy and financial management issues.
• Develop and implement operational policies, procedures and practices that facilitate and support management accounting within the agency.
• Contribute to a change management and performance development culture across the unit by participating in regular two-way feedback discussions with your supervisor and team members.
